The Advisory Council serves to advise the Area Agency on Aging of Palm Beach/Treasure Coast, Inc. on all matters relating to the development of the Area Plan, the administration of the plan and the operations conducted under the plan.
The Area Plan guides the development and coordination of community-based systems of service for persons age 60 and older, adults with disabilities and their caregivers in Planning and Service Area (PSA) 9, consisting of the counties of Indian River, Martin, Okeechobee, Palm Beach and St. Lucie, and to advance the Agency's mission to promote, support and advocate for the independence, dignity and wellbeing of seniors, adults with disabilities and those who care for them in a manner that values diversity, reflects the communities we serve and embraces the collaboration of the aging network.
